“Valor passado do pai em ReactJs” Respostas de código

Valor passado do pai em ReactJs

var json = require("json!../languages.json");
var jsonArray = json.languages;

export class SelectLanguage extends React.Component {
    state = {
            selectedCode: '',
            selectedLanguage: jsonArray[0],
        }

    handleLangChange = () => {
        var lang = this.dropdown.value;
        this.props.onSelectLanguage(lang);            
    }

    render() {
        return (
            <div>
                <DropdownList ref={(ref) => this.dropdown = ref}
                    data={jsonArray} 
                    valueField='lang' textField='lang'
                    caseSensitive={false} 
                    minLength={3}
                    filter='contains'
                    onChange={this.handleLangChange} />
            </div>            
        );
    }
}
Dark Duck

Valor passado do pai em ReactJs

class ParentComponent extends React.Component {

    state = { language: '' }

    handleLanguage = (langValue) => {
        this.setState({language: langValue});
    }

    render() {
         return (
                <div className="col-sm-9">
                    <SelectLanguage onSelectLanguage={this.handleLanguage} /> 
                </div>
        )
     }
}
Dark Duck

Respostas semelhantes a “Valor passado do pai em ReactJs”

Perguntas semelhantes a “Valor passado do pai em ReactJs”

Mais respostas relacionadas para “Valor passado do pai em ReactJs” em JavaScript

Procure respostas de código populares por idioma

Procurar outros idiomas de código